[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/DEVS_MYCTU DEVS_MYCTU] Member of the two-component regulatory system DevR/DevS (DosR/DosS) involved in onset of the dormancy response. May act as a redox sensor (rather than a direct hypoxia sensor); the normal (aerobic growth) state is the Fe(3+) form, while the reduced (anaerobic growth) Fe(2+) form is probably active for phosphate transfer. It is probably reduced by flavin nucleotides such as FMN and FAD. May be the primary sensor for CO. Donates a phosphate group to DevR (DosR).<ref>PMID:15033981</ref> <ref>PMID:18474359</ref> <ref>PMID:18400743</ref>
